错误代码:
java.lang.OutOfMemoryError: PermGen space
原因分析:
myeclipse或tomcat的内容分配的不够用,启动失败
解决方法:
1.找到tomcat安装文件夹的这个文件\apache-tomcat-7.0.41\bin\catalina.bat,打开,在里面找到这句:rem ----- Execute The Requested Command 。在这句以下加入:set JAVA_OPTS=%JAVA_OPTS% -Xms256m -Xmx1024m -XX:PermSize=256M -XX:MaxNewSize=256m -XX:MaxPermSize=512m
2.在window->preferences->Myeclipse->tomcat->tomcat7->jdk里面增加:-Xms256m -Xmx256m -XX:MaxNewSize=256m -XX:MaxPermSize=256m
3.重新启动myeclipse就可以。
相关文章
- MyEclipse中项目运行时发生了Tomcat报错:[java.lang.OutOfMemoryError: PermGen space]
- Tomcat:Caused by: java.lang.OutOfMemoryError: PermGen space的解决方案
- Eclipse中启动tomcat报错java.lang.OutOfMemoryError: PermGen space的解决方法
- Tomcat错误之java.lang.OutOfMemoryError:PermGen space解决方案
- Tomcat发生java.lang.OutOfMemoryError: PermGen space的解决方案
- Eclipse中启动tomcat: java.lang.OutOfMemoryError: PermGen space的解决方法
- Eclipse中通过Tomcat运行J2EE项目java.lang.OutOfMemoryError: PermGen space的解决方案
- MyEclipse启动tomcat出现java.lang.OutOfMemoryError: PermGen space 的解决方案
- Eclipse中通过Tomcat运行J2EE项目java.lang.OutOfMemoryError: PermGen space的解决方案
- Eclipse中通过Tomcat运行JavaWeb项目发生内存溢出:java.lang.OutOfMemoryError: PermGen space 错误的解决方案